MLX90614-BAA Contactless IR Temperature Sensor Module Serial Interface
Description
- Features:
- Power supply: 3-5v
- Current: 5mA
- Baud rate: 9600 or 115200
- Default auto output frequency: 14HZ
- Measurement range:
- -40… +125 C degree for ambient temperature
- -70… +380 C degree for measurement target temperature
- Measuring distance: close range 1-2cm

controller(sixteen hex) - 1.Frame header:0xa5
- Instruction format: header+instructions+Check and (8bit) (such as automatic
reading of temperature instructions=0xA5+0x45+0xEA) - 2.Command instruction:
- Continuous output instruction:
- 0xA5+0x45+0xEA—————-Temperature data (module return data type 0x45)
- Query output instruction:
- – 0xA5+0x15+0xBATemperature data (module return data type 0x45)
- Configuration instruction:(after Power down reset will active)
- Baud rate configuration:
- 0xA5+0xAE+0x53—————9600 (default)
- 0xA5+0xAF+0x54—————115200
- Power on whether automatic transmit temperature data configuration:
- 0xA5+0x51+0xF6—————Automatic output temperature data after power
up(default) - 0xA5+0x52+0xF7—————Not automatic output temperature data after power up
- Communication protocol:
- Serial port receive:
- (1) Serial communication parameters (the default baud rate value 9600 BPS, can
be set by software - Baud rate:9600 BPS Check bit:N Data bits:Eight Stop bit:1
- Baud rate:115200 BPS Check bit:N Data bits:Eight Stop bit:1
- (2) Module output format, each frame contains9Bytes (sixteen decimal):
- 1. Byte0: 0x5A Header flag
- 2. Byte1: 0x5A Header flag
- 3. Byte2: 0X45 Data type of the frame(0X45: Temperature data)
- 4. Byte3: 0x04 Data volume (below 4 data make 2 Groups as an example)
- 5. Byte4: 0x00~0xFF Data 1 high 8 position
- 6. Byte5: 0x00~0xFF Data 1 low 8 position
- 7. Byte6: 0x00~0xFF Data 2 high 8 position
- 8. Byte7: 0x00~0xFF Data 2 low 8 position
- 9. Byte8: 0x00~0xFF Checksum(preceding data accumulate, leaving only low 8 bit)
- (3) Data calculation method
- Temperature calculation method :
- temperature=high 8 position<<8|low 8 bit(The result is 100 multiplied by the actual
angle) - Example: send Instruction: A5 45 EA, received One frame data:
- <5A- 5A- 45- 04- 0C- 78- 0D- 19- A7 >
- Express TO (There is a sign 16 bit, which represents the target
temperature):TO=0x0C78/100=31.92C - Express TA (There is a sign 16 bit, indicates the ambient
temperature:TO=0x0D19/100=33.53C - Usage method:
- The module is the serial output data, user through the serial port connection, send
output instructions, such as 0xA5+0x45+0xEA To the module, the module will be
continuous output temperature data; if you want to query output,you can send
0xA5+0x15+0xBA To the module, every time to send, the module will return a
temperature data, the query frequency should be lower than 10Hz, if required more
than 10Hz continuous output mode, Please send 0xA5+0x45+0xEA Instruction.
